Niacin affects all lipid parameters favorably. It is one of the only agents that reduces Lp (a) significantly (up to 30 per cent). Unfortunately, compliance is poor because of frequent side effects. Flushing and pruritus, gastrointestinal discomfort, glucose intolerance, and hyperuricemia often accompany use of niacin, hepatotoxicity is rare but is more commonly seen with the sustained released preparation. It is often heralded by a dramatic reduction in lipid levels. There are limited data on long-term therapy with this agent. Niacin may be particularly useful for patients who do not have substantial elevations in their LDL-C levels, and low doses may be used to treat diabetic dyslipidemia. High doses should be avoided in those with a history of gout, peptic ulcer disease, or active hepatic disease. Extended release preparations are to be used and not sustained release ones.
